My Favorite Brunch Recipes for New Year’s Day

Ring in the New Year with some Home Cooked Delicious and Healthy Food you make yourself! Stay in and enjoy a leisurely brunch – many recipes can be made ahead of time. Breakfast Fried Egg Tacos with Karen's Bloody Mary Hot Sauce

Breakfast Fried Egg Tacos with Karen's Bloody Mary Hot Sauce

Wake up your taste buds with these savory tacos! Sunny side up fried eggs top tacos and a bevy of veggies and Mexican cheeses. Top with my homemade spicy hot sauce for the perfect chile-tang.
Prep Time: 10 minutes
8 minutes
Total Time: 18 minutes
Servings: 4 tacos
Print Recipe Pin Recipe
Rate this Recipe

Ingredients

  • 4 whole corn tortillas*
  • 1 teaspoon extra virgin olive oil divided
  • 4 large eggs I use pasture raise for flavor and deep orange yolks
  • 12 tablespoons mexican grated cheeses see note

Veggies & Add-Ons:

  • 4 tablespoons avocado peeled, thinly sliced
  • 2 teaspoons scallions chopped on the diagonal
  • 2 teaspoons pickled sliced red onions
  • 1 tablespoon sliced cherry tomatoes multi-colored
  • 1 teaspoon cilantro (or parsley) chopped
  • 1 teaspoon fresh or pickled jalapeño thinly sliced
  • 2 teaspoons thinly sliced radishes I use watermelon radish
  • hot sauce see my recipe: Bloody Mary Hot Sauce

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
  • Brush your seasoned cast iron skillet with 1/2 teaspoon evoo and the insides metal rings if using (for round fried eggs.)
    Set heat to medium. Add 4 eggs, spacing them (add to center of rings in skillet if using.)
    Cook for two minutes until egg whites have set (yolks will finish cooking in the oven.)
  • Remove the eggs to a plate, wipe the skillet clean, brush skillet with remaining 1/2 teaspoon evoo. Add 4 tortillas and cook for one minute one each side until warmed through.
  • Add the tortillas to a baking tray. Top each with 1 1/2 tablespoons of grated cheese. Top each with the fried egg. Add 1 1/2 tablespoons extra grated cheese around the egg whites and tortillas. Bake in the oven for 5 - 7 minutes; or until the cheese is bubbly and the yolks are cooked to your desired doneness.
  • Garnish and Enjoy the Tacos:
  • Add your desired toppings to each taco and drizzle all over with the hot sauce.

Notes

*Tortillas: I use Vista Hermosa Corn Tortillas. They are gluten free, non GMO and organic with minimal ingredients and NO artificial preservatives. Delicious! 
Mexican Cheeses: Use a mixture of cheeses or crumbled Queso Fresco cheese.
